The Meadville Tribune ( http://bit.ly/XU9aMr0) reports 47-year-old Deidre Stoll apologized and said, "I never wanted him to die."
She was sentenced Tuesday after a plea bargain to voluntary manslaughter.
Police say 50-year-old Willis Stoll had grabbed her arm and pinned her to the wall during an argument on Sept. 11, 2011 and that she reacted by grabbing a kitchen knife on a nightstand and stabbing him in the side.
Deidre Stoll applied pressure to the wound and called 911, but her husband died at a hospital three days later.
The woman must also reimburse her stepdaughter for about $8,500 in funeral expenses.
